CVE-2022-38355
Last modified
CVE-2022-38355 is a medium-severity vulnerability rated 5.5/10 on the CVSS scale. Daikin SVMPC1 version 2.1.22 and prior and SVMPC2 version 1.2.3 and prior are vulnerable to attackers with access to the local area network (LAN) to disclose sensitive information stored by the affected product without requiring authentication. . EPSS estimates a 0.41% chance of exploitation in the next 30 days.
